Resume writing tips for Benefits Consultants

Crafting a Benefits Consultant resume requires precision and clarity to stand out in a crowded field. Instead of generic phrases, focus on demonstrating measurable impact and aligning your title with job descriptions. Clear evidence of how your work improved benefits programs will capture hiring managers’ attention effectively.
  • Avoid vague terms like "managed benefits programs"; instead, specify the types of programs and highlight measurable improvements, such as cost savings or increased employee satisfaction.
  • Replace generic titles with exact job titles found in Benefits Consultant postings to ensure your resume passes automated scans and resonates with recruiters.
  • Showcase your ability to communicate value by quantifying achievements in your summary, such as percentage improvements or stakeholder outcomes.
  • Focus bullet points on results by describing how your actions led to specific enhancements in benefits administration, compliance, or employee engagement.

Resume Summaries for Benefits Consultants

As a benefits consultant, you're constantly communicating value and results to stakeholders. Your resume summary should mirror this skill by immediately showcasing your expertise and quantifiable achievements. Think of it as your strategic positioning statement that demonstrates how you drive cost savings, improve employee satisfaction, and navigate complex regulatory environments.

Most job descriptions require that a benefits consultant has a certain amount of experience. That means this isn't a detail to bury. You need to make it stand out in your summary. Lead with your years of experience, highlight specific areas like ERISA compliance or vendor management, and include measurable outcomes. Skip generic objectives unless you lack relevant experience. Align every statement with the employer's specific needs.

Resume FAQs for Benefits Consultants:

How long should I make my Benefits Consultant resume?

A Benefits Consultant resume should ideally be one to two pages long. This length allows you to highlight relevant experience and skills without overwhelming the reader. Focus on showcasing your expertise in benefits administration, client management, and regulatory compliance. Use bullet points for clarity and prioritize recent and impactful achievements. Tailor your resume to each job application by emphasizing the most pertinent experiences and skills for the specific role.

What is the best way to format my Benefits Consultant resume?

A hybrid resume format is best for Benefits Consultants, combining chronological and functional elements. This format highlights your career progression while emphasizing key skills like analytical abilities and client relations. Include sections such as a professional summary, skills, work experience, and education. Use clear headings and consistent formatting. Quantify achievements to demonstrate your impact, such as "Reduced benefits costs by 15% through strategic plan redesign."

What certifications should I include on my Benefits Consultant resume?

Relevant certifications for Benefits Consultants include Certified Employee Benefit Specialist (CEBS), Professional in Human Resources (PHR), and Certified Benefits Professional (CBP). These certifications demonstrate your expertise in benefits management and commitment to professional development. List certifications prominently in a dedicated section, including the certifying body and year obtained. This highlights your qualifications and assures employers of your up-to-date industry knowledge and skills.

What are the most common mistakes to avoid on a Benefits Consultant resume?

Common mistakes on Benefits Consultant resumes include vague job descriptions, lack of quantifiable achievements, and outdated information. Avoid these by clearly detailing your responsibilities and using metrics to showcase your impact, such as "Implemented a new benefits program, increasing employee satisfaction by 20%." Regularly update your resume to reflect recent roles and skills. Ensure clarity and professionalism by proofreading for errors and maintaining a clean, organized layout.
